❓:Describe the significance of the Magna Carta in shaping modern democracy.
🧠
🔑:The Magna Carta, signed in 1215, is significant in shaping modern democracy as it established the principle that no one, including the king, is above the law. It laid the foundation for individual rights and liberties and influenced later constitutional documents, ensuring that citizens have a say in governance and protection from arbitrary authority.

❓:Differentiate between a simile and a metaphor with examples.
🧠
🔑:A simile is a figure of speech comparing two different things using "like" or "as," such as "Her smile is like sunshine." A metaphor makes a direct comparison by stating one thing is another, like "Time is a thief," suggesting that time steals moments from our lives without explicitly using "like" or "as."
